Kuala Lumpur: Prime Minister Datuk Seri Anwar Ibrahim emphasised that close cooperation between state and federal leaders is essential to ensure the aspirations of the people are realised in a comprehensive and inclusive manner.

The Pakatan Harapan (PH) Chairman said he had held a meeting with Barisan Nasional (BN) Chairman Datuk Seri Dr Ahmad Zahid Hamidi and Gabungan Rakyat Sabah (GRS) Chairman Datuk Seri Hajiji Noor, conducted in a harmonious atmosphere marked by camaraderie.

“This meeting reflects political maturity and a commitment to strengthening cooperation to ensure the country’s stability, particularly in the context of relations between the Federal Government and Sabah.

“I believe political stability is a crucial foundation for advancing development agendas and safeguarding the welfare of the people,” he said in a Facebook post.

Anwar, who is also PKR President, expressed hope that this spirit of consensus will continue to underpin stronger national unity, leading to a progressive, just and prosperous future for all in Malaysia.

PH is in separate pacts with GRS and BN for the Sabah election, as the two coalitions have refused to work together despite Anwar’s urging.

Sabah BN previously said any form of cooperation with GRS would only be considered after the outcome of the state polls, which must be held by December.
